Maggie Moo’s on U Street Under New Ownership, Seeks New Name

30 August 2009 11:30 PM | By Prince Of Petworth in Neighborhoods - U Street

Maggie Moo’s, originally uploaded by epmd.

Many have probably noticed that the sign from Maggie Moo’s located at 1301 U St NW has come down. I just learned that the new owners, who are keeping it an ice cream spot, are the same folks behind Aroma Bakery and Market on U Street which we looked at last week. The owners, Steve and Sose, notified me this weekend that they are the new owners of the spot as of Monday. And they are looking for a new name. So if you have a good suggestion for an ice cream store on U Street please leave it in the comments section.
